Advice:
Do not experiment with equipment - use good filters, lights and CO2.
Pay attention where you place your planted tank. If you have some direct light in the house, other than aquarium light, pointed on aquarium at time when aquarium light is turned off - you will get algae.

Advice:
always make sure all electrical items that you intened to put in your tank are earthed. as i found out the hard way that not doing this can have disasterous conciquences.
